PROBLEM ADDRESSED

USING COMPUTERIZATION TO REDUCE MEDICATION ERRORS With increased patient awareness of the health care delivery situations , media flare up and public opinions medical practice has become more accountable today and there is a radical departure from the traditional medical practice which draws upon the personal experiences , case studies and research of the physician and not the health care delivery system as a whole entity . Modern Science has bestowed Health care delivery system with excellent technological innovations . One such innovation is the Computerization of the entire health care delivery system . Computerization has contributed enormously towards the reduction of medical errors and the problems associated with such errors . This includes computerization of the medical records popularly known as the Electronic Medical Record System (EMR ) in digital format , Electronic Prescriptions , Personal Digital Assistants , Computer automated cancer detection and Computerized theatre management applications

THE PROBLEM QUESTION

The PICO format is a convenient way to frame and design problem questions . As per PICO format the

Patients : The patients to be addressed are patients under all categories who will be benefited by computerization of medical procedures

Intervention : Using computerization to reduce medical errors

Comparison : The intervention will be compared with the current method of medical procedures in practice that contributes to or reduces medical errors

Outcomes : The expected outcome of using computerization in medical procedures is to reduce medical errors of all kinds

Based on the PICO format , the question of this is : Does using computers in medical procedures reduce medical errors
